Runbook: Veldmark template rendering slowdowns

Symptom: p95 render time over 800ms on the Veldmark doc service. Check TEMPLATE_CACHE_SIZE first; anything under 512 causes thrash. Set TEMPLATE_CACHE_SIZE=1024 and TEMPLATE_PRECOMPILE=true in the renderer .env, then restart. Do not enable debug tracing in prod — it disables the cache entirely. Note for review: precompiled templates are fetched from the artifact store, which requires an access secret. Confirm rotation date, then append the secret line immediately after the cache settings:

secret setting of yajog-taguf: ARCHIVE_KEY3=051

## Support

The `tailwisp` CLI is maintained by the Observability Pod at Quillmark. Before filing a ticket, run `tailwisp doctor` and attach its output; this catches most auth and buffer-size issues. Known limitations, including the 10k-line scrollback cap, are tracked in the pod's backlog. For anything not covered there, or for access requests to production log streams, reach the maintainers at the address below.

escalation mailbox, hadug-bajog: sormir@norvalabs.internal

## Partner SFTP Drop — Marlowe Freight

Files land nightly between 02:00–03:30 UTC in the inbound drop. Watcher job `marlowe-ingest` picks them up; if nothing arrives by 04:00, the Quillhook alert fires. Do NOT re-request files from Marlowe before checking the quarantine folder — malformed headers get parked there silently. Retries are safe; ingest is idempotent on file checksum. Rotation of the drop credentials is quarterly, owned by platform. Full escalation steps and contacts are on the runbook page.

dashboard of taduf-tahof = https://confluence.tolvaqlabs.internal/browse/browse/display/f01240ca